ZWILLING J.A. Henckels is a globally recognized company with nearly 300 years of heritage in crafting premium cutlery and cookware. Renowned for quality, craftsmanship, and innovation, ZWILLING has expanded its offerings beyond cutlery to include cookware, kitchen tools, tabletop items, small electrics, and personal care products. Through acquisitions of heritage brands like Staub, Demeyere, Ballarini, and MIYABI, ZWILLING has solidified its position as a leader in the kitchenware industry, distributing products in over 100 countries worldwide. The company is synonymous with tradition and excellence, continuously innovating to meet the needs of both professional and home chefs across the globe.
